Transaction 5fab9bd7480986d476f5d9a143da22b402a862335e643d547cf83edb9e22127b

1 Input
2 Outputs
  • 5fab9bd7480986d476f5d9a143da22b402a862335e643d547cf83edb9e22127b:0
  • value  15042
    address  39SWEMRdwNQPKEzNtaM32zu9gZBYifpKhV
  • 5fab9bd7480986d476f5d9a143da22b402a862335e643d547cf83edb9e22127b:1
  • value  16957586
    address  35XGpmZXvbKG2MUKgD7oFKedBzfjHmfVxp